版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
第六章可编程控制器技术知识延伸:GRAPH语言的应用GRAPH语言初识定义:GRAPH语言基于IEC61131-3标准的SFC语言,是S7-1200/1500系列PLC支持的专用编程语言核心特点:以“状态”和“转移条件”为核心构建程序,将复杂流程拆解为清晰步骤与其他语言的区别:相比LAD的电气逻辑、SCL的代码逻辑,更侧重流程的顺序性与可视化GRAPH语言核心要素状态(Step):流程中的独立步骤,包含动作指令(如电机启动、阀门开启)转移条件(Transition):连接两个状态的判断条件(如传感器信号、时间延迟)分支结构:并行分支:多个状态同时执行(如两侧零件同步抓取)选择分支:根据条件进入不同子流程(如检测合格/不合格的分流处理)特殊逻辑:跳转(跳过某状态)、循环(重复某段流程)的实现方式GRAPH语言适用场景典型应用场景多步骤顺序控制(如产品装配:上料→定位→拧紧→检测→下料)周期性流程(如包装线:取盒→装料→封口→贴标循环)带逻辑分支的工序(如检测不合格时的返工流程)优点比LAD:流程步骤更直观,避免复杂触点连锁比SCL:无需大量代码描述顺序,逻辑一目了然实战案例——GRAPH控制装配生产线工序GRAPH程序设计状态定义:S1(等待上料)、S2(焊接执行)、S3(质量检测)、S4(成品下料)转移条件S1→S2:上料传感器I0.0=1S2→S3:焊接完成信号Q0.1=1且延时2秒S3→S4:检测合格信号I0.2=1(合格)或人工确认信号I0.3=1(不合格返工后)并行分支应用:焊接时同步进行下一物料上料准备GRAPH语言优势与注意事项核心优势流程可视化:状态与转移清晰,便于团队理解与维护逻辑简化:复杂顺序控制无需大量触点串联,减少出错调试高效:可直接监控当前状态,快速定位故障点注意事项避免过度分支:过多并行或嵌套分支可能导致逻辑混乱转移条件明确:需避免“死循环”(如条件永远不满足)或“跳步
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 网络安全防护与用户隐私保护手册-1
- 航空乘务员服务技能与应急处置手册
- 公路运输与物流服务手册
- 互联网支付业务运营与管理手册
- 互联网数据分析与用户画像手册
- 宠物出行护理及应激防护管理指南手册
- 导尿护理质量标准与评估方法
- 2025年餐桌上的招聘面试评估应聘者的性格
- 诗歌鉴赏技巧市公开课获奖课件百校联赛一等奖课件
- 六 直流电动机说课稿-2025-2026学年初中物理九年级全册北师大版(闫金铎)
- 2026重庆中医药学院第一批招聘非在编人员10人笔试备考题库及答案解析
- 2026新疆喀什地区才聚喀什智惠丝路春季招才引智226人笔试模拟试题及答案解析
- 2026年北京市海淀区初三一模化学试卷(含答案)
- 2026年上海市嘉定区高三下学期二模化学试卷和答案
- 钉钉内部审批制度流程
- 2026中国东方航空第二期国际化储备人才招聘备考题库及参考答案详解一套
- 模具加工异常奖惩制度
- 【答案】《人工智能数学思维与应用》(杭州电子科技大学)章节期末慕课答案
- 2025年水下机器人探测精度五年技术报告
- 2025年中核集团校招笔试题库及答案
- 医疗设备人员培训方案范文
评论
0/150
提交评论